Check Digit Verification of cas no
The CAS Registry Mumber 212778-82-0 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 2,1,2,7,7 and 8 respectively; the second part has 2 digits, 8 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 212778-82:
(8*2)+(7*1)+(6*2)+(5*7)+(4*7)+(3*8)+(2*8)+(1*2)=140
140 % 10 = 0
So 212778-82-0 is a valid CAS Registry Number.

Pyrazine compounds
-
, (2008/06/13)
A compound of formula (I) wherein R1is selected from the group consisting of phenyl substituted by one or more halogen atoms, naphthyl and naphthyl substituted by one or more halogen atoms; R2is selected from the group consisting of —NH2and —NHC(═O)Ra; R3is selected from the group consisting of —NRbRc, —NHC(═O)Raand hydrogen, R4is selected from the group consisting of hydrogen, -C1-4alkyl, -C1-4alkyl substituted by one or more halogen atoms, —CN, —CH2OH, —CH2ORdand —CH2S(O)xRd; wherein Rarepresents C1-4alkyl or C3-7cycloalkyl, and Rband Rc, which may be the same or different, are selected from hydrogen and C1-4alkyl, or together with the nitrogen atom to which they are attached, form a6-membered nitrogen containing heterocycle, which heterocycle can be further susbtituted with one or more C1-4alkyl; Rdis selected from C1-4alkyl or C1-4alkyl substituted by one or more halogen atoms; x is an integer zero, one or two; and pharmaceutically acceptable derivatives thereof; with the proviso that R1does not represent (a); when R2is —NH2, and both R3and R4are hydrogen.
